The Motor Carrier Act shall not apply to:
A. school buses, provided that school buses shall be subject to applicable school bus safety provisions established by the state transportation director;
B. United States mail carriers, unless they are engaged in other business as motor carriers of persons or household goods;
C. hearses, funeral coaches or other motor vehicles belonging to or operated in connection with the business of a funeral service practitioner licensed by the state;
D. a county or municipal public bus transportation system;
E. private carriers; or
F. commuter services.
